Who Saw Her Die? (Italian: ) is a 1972 Italian giallo film directed by Aldo Lado and starring George Lazenby. In this film, the parents of their murdered daughter search for the killer as the body count grows.
A young girl is brutally murdered somewhere in France. Sometime later, the same thing happens to the daughter of a well-known sculptor. This time the parents (the sculptor and his wife) start investigating, and soon find they are in way over their head. Meanwhile, the body-count keeps rising as the killer now starts butchering all those who find out too much...
